    I'm grateful to have been able to experience the 80s in general, never mind the amazing glitz and glamour of that era... Usually and especially music artists, grab the attention of a particular age group during the beginning of their careers. Michael Jackson was not the usual music artist... He grabbed the attention of children, teenagers, college aged and even parents during the 80s... And everybody had Michael Jackson paraphernalia... From, notebooks, posters, record and cassette collections, to trending clothing styles such as the red leather jackets and pants and the white glove, and outward appearances like the lookalikes in this video... Just hearing his songs played on the radio made women scream in excitement! Magazine covers, television appearances, and concerts, were the must sees. Michael Jackson took the 80s by storm! And it was the best storm to ever hit my childhood in the 70s and 80s...

    I was there 💯!!! Imagine a world where Michael Jackson was mentioned every single day.. on the news.. in every magazine.. all the magazines for teens/kids.. new books weekly.. on tv constantly.. you could buy the bubblegum/stickers in every shop that sold candy and gum.. and posters, buttons and badges.. where on sale everywhere!!! And this is all before discussing that the Thriller album was Everywhere!! And the soundtrack for that entire era.. 83-84 - then imagine MTV/ music videos were still very new.. and Michael Jackson videos were like mini Motion pictures! I.e.- Thriller.. It was Michael mania!!! For Real!!!! Anyone who was really there understands exactly what I mean if I say... “the rolling stone red and white shirt picture “ “The brown leather jacket and blue jeans with a guitar belt poster” and “The yellow vest and bow tie with white pants and shirt poster”!!! If you know... you know! RIP Magical Michael! 💜
